My name is Courage Kim, and I specialize in proposal, engagement, and event photography. Photography, to me, is about telling your story with honesty, heart, and artistry. What I love most are the in-between moments, the nervous laughter, the quick glance, the subtle touch, that often go unseen. Anyone can capture a kiss or the big “yes,” but it’s in those fleeting, quiet in-betweens that real emotions live, and that’s where I find my art.

I first discovered photography in high school, when I signed up for an elective class and met a teacher who encouraged me to express myself through the lens. Back then, I never thought photography would become more than a hobby. But years later, when I captured the moment of a father teaching his daughter to fish, I realized that photography wasn’t just about pictures—it was about preserving emotions, telling stories, and giving people the ability to relive moments that would otherwise fade.

Creativity has always been part of who I am. Through music, I’ve learned how to connect with people and tell stories that reach the heart. Photography became another extension of that.
